Transmission of the electrical signal from the dendrites to the soma of a neuron occurs by which of the following?

#Unit 7. System Physiology – Animal
  1. Short-circuit current flow
  2. An action potential mechanism
  3. Electrotonic conduction
  4. Capacitive discharge


Answer:- Option(s): 3
